General Information

Work Title Un hiver à Paris
Alternative. Title Un hiver à Paris ou Rêveries napolitaines
Composer Donizetti, Gaetano
Opus/Catalogue NumberOp./Cat. No. A 201-207
I-Catalogue NumberI-Cat. No. None [force assignment]
Movements/SectionsMov'ts/Sec's 7 songs:
  1. Il pescatore / Le pêcheur du Danube (A 201)
  2. La ninna nonna [La ninna nanna] / La mère au berceau de son fils (A 202 ; In.388)
  3. Il trovatore in caricatura / Le troubadour à la belle étoile. Scène bouffe (A 203)
  4. La sultana / La sultane (A 204)
  5. La dernière nuit d'un novice / L'ultima notte di un novizio (A 205)
  6. L'addio (A 206 ; In.375)
  7. La folle de Sainte Hélène / La pazza di Sant'Elena (A 207)
Text Incipit see below
  1. Era l'ora che i cieli / C'était l'heure où tout est silencieux
  2. Dormi fanciullo mio / Dors, l'enfant de ta mère
  3. Era notte e la campana / Chaque lumière est éteinte
  4. Là sedeva, sull'erton verone / Riche et belle, hélas!
  5. Demain, quand sonnera l'heure de la prière / Doman, quando la squilla annunzi la preghiera
  6. Dunque addio, mio caro
  7. Ils disent tous que je suis folle / Stolta ognor me il mondo grida
First Publication. 1839 – Naples: Girard
Librettist see below
  1. Achille de Lauzières (1818-1894?), after Friedrich Schiller (1759-1805); Frédéric de Courcy (1796–1862), French text
  2. Achille de Lauzières (1818-1894?); Frédéric de Courcy (1796–1862), French text
  3. Lorenzo Borsini (1800-1855); Frédéric de Courcy (1796–1862), French text
  4. Leopoldo Tarantini (1811-1882); Frédéric de Courcy (1796–1862), French text
  5. Adolphe Nourrit (1802-1839)
  6. Felice Romani (1788-1865); Gustave Vaëz (1812–1862), French text
  7. Adolphe Nourrit (1802-1839)
Language Italian, French
Dedication see below
7. Madame de Coussy
Composer Time PeriodComp. Period Romantic
Piece Style Romantic
Instrumentation voice, piano
